M.Ed. in C&I – Mathematics Education is a master’s only program that does not lead to initial teacher certification. The online graduate program emphasizes teaching math to K-12 students using problem-based learning strategies that are relevant to math disciplines and focused on how people learn. The content of mathematics is emphasized in the context of how to teach this content to students.
The UTA Education Program also addresses issues affecting learning by providing educators with tools on topics such as scientific/other conceptual fallacies, logic-mathematical and scientific reasoning, and motivation.
M.Ed. in Mathematics Education, designed to provide practicing teachers with the results of current research and teaching excellence in mathematics education. The 30-hour degree includes core courses on curriculum design, learning strategies, and diversity in education. Also includes courses in research methods in education and a focus on mathematics or mathematics education.

The University of Texas at Arlington is a full member of the Association for Teacher Education Excellence (AAQEP), a national accrediting organization recognized by the Higher Education Accreditation Council. AAQEP has awarded this program full accreditation through June 30, 2028. Full accreditation recognizes that the program produces effective educators who continue to grow as professionals and have demonstrated a commitment and ability to maintain quality.
Master of Education in Curriculum and Teaching – Mathematics education does not lead to licensing in the State of Texas.
Out-of-state students seeking certification in their home state should review the licensing requirements with their state education agency to determine whether completion of a Master of Education in Curriculum and Teaching program will result in a math license in their home state.

A candidate who meets all the requirements is considered unconditionally accepted. Unqualified students must maintain a 3.0 GPA throughout the program and have a 3.0 GPA for graduation. Requirements include:
An applicant who does not meet all of the requirements for unconditional admission may demonstrate promise of success in graduate studies and, with the recommendation of the Graduate Studies Advisor, the Graduate Studies Committee, and with the approval of the Academic Dean, may be allowed admission on probation. Students admitted on probation to any graduate program at the College of Education must achieve a GPA of 3.0 with at least a B in the first nine credit hours of study. In addition, in order to graduate from UTA and the College of Education, all applicants must have a GPA of at least 3.0.
